Law Center – Advancing Justice to Prevent and End Homelessness Nationwide
The Law Center is a nationally recognized legal advocacy organization committed to ending homelessness and advancing the civil and human rights of unhoused individuals across the United States. In 2022 and early 2023, the Law Center initiated a transformative strategic planning process to align its mission, values, and goals with the evolving needs of the communities it serves. This effort included collaboration with national, state, and local partners, individuals with lived experience of homelessness, and the organization’s full board and staff—ensuring a truly inclusive and responsive approach to the next phase of impact.
With this new three-year strategic plan, the Law Center is boldly committed to fearlessly advancing federal, state, and local policies that aim to prevent and ultimately end homelessness. At the same time, the organization remains unwavering in its mission to fiercely defend the civil liberties and human rights of all people experiencing homelessness, particularly those disproportionately affected by racial, economic, and social inequities.
A Strategic Approach to Homelessness Advocacy
The Law Center’s work focuses on using the power of the law to drive systemic change. With expertise in litigation, policy reform, education, and coalition building, the organization develops and implements comprehensive strategies that address the root causes of homelessness. These include lack of affordable housing, discrimination, inadequate access to healthcare, and the criminalization of poverty.
Through this strategic plan, the Law Center seeks to:
Influence housing policy at all levels of government to ensure access to safe, stable, and affordable housing.
Protect unhoused individuals from criminalization and discriminatory practices.
Collaborate with communities, service providers, and policymakers to implement effective solutions based on lived experience and evidence-based practices.
Advocate for economic justice, healthcare access, and systemic equity across all sectors affecting homelessness.
